Output ec6cb793024fa539d4d8acb0a9bd1d2189c88ef75c91f27c10ee75bd51b38498:0

value
195187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 482faa2d4266867aaad0d8c5400857ae9272c1e9 OP_EQUAL
address
38GhgAGgJKs2fnDrFCgvEwALAffLqy8mGN
transaction
ec6cb793024fa539d4d8acb0a9bd1d2189c88ef75c91f27c10ee75bd51b38498
confirmations
426797
spent
true